1 / What Should I Bring?
Reflections Retreat Vanuatu is a relaxed environment, so pack light and bring only what you need for a comfortable holiday.
​
If you plan to self-cater, we recommend purchasing groceries (and BYO alcohol) in Port Vila before you arrive.
​
Essentials include a sun hat, swimmers, rashies, sunscreen, thongs or slip-on sandals, shorts, and t-shirts. Reef shoes are recommended for water activities, and you’re welcome to bring your own snorkelling gear (we also provide gear).
​
Vanuatu uses the same power plugs as Australia and New Zealand, so no adaptor is needed for electronics.
​
2 / Do You Have Wi-Fi?
We have limited internet and telephone coverage on-site. Wi-Fi is available in the communal area and in the private cottage for guest use.
3 / Where Can I Buy Supplies?
Supermarkets and convenience stores in Port Vila stock groceries, essentials, and alcohol. For fresh local fruit and vegetables, the Mama Markets are a great option. Many guests like to pick up supplies in Port Vila on their way to Reflections.
